Men's Golf In Fifth After 36 Holes of CBC Spring Invitational

            Cabot, Ark. – Playing on their home course for the first time this season, Central Baptist College men's golf hosted the CBC Spring Invitational at Cypress Creek Golf Course. CBC is in fifth place after shooting a 36-hole score of 623, 21 shots behind the leaders Mineral Area College.

            Individually, Paul Gomez is tied for fourth after shooting a 149, five shots off the lead. Cooper Hermann is next in a tie for eighth after shooting a 151. Jakub Slapal shot a 159, Jack Higginbotham shot a 164, Preston Nestorenko, competing as an individual, shot a 169 and Gustavo Bello shot a 173.

            The final 18 holes will commence at 8:30 a.m. tomorrow.
